About BrowserStack
BrowserStack is the world's leading software testing platform, enabling developers to conduct over 2 million tests daily across 19 global data centers. By offering a cloud-based testing platform, BrowserStack empowers developers and QA teams to ensure quality software for the 5 billion internet users worldwide. Trusted by industry giants such as Tesco, Shell, NVIDIA, and Wells Fargo, BrowserStack is revolutionizing how software testing is done, with a focus on scalability and performance.
Founded: 2011
Website: www.browserstack.com
Job Details
- Position: Software Engineer
- Location: Remote (India)
- Experience: 1-3 years
- Eligibility: Bachelor's in Science, IT, Computer Science, or equivalent
- Salary: ₹15-20 LPA (Via Glassdoor)
BrowserStack is looking for talented Software Engineers to design and develop scalable systems and applications. Join a dynamic, agile engineering team working on high-impact solutions.
Skills Needed
- Proficiency in programming languages such as Ruby, Node.js, Python, Java, or C/C++
- Strong knowledge of operating systems, databases, and networking concepts
- Experience with both Windows and Linux platforms, including file systems, kernels, and custom installations
- Ability to work effectively in an agile team and communicate across technical and non-technical roles
- Creative problem-solving and diagnostic skills
Job Responsibilities
- Design, develop, document, and support systems and applications used by a large developer community.
- Collaborate with cross-functional teams to deliver scalable solutions aligned with business goals.
- Participate in code reviews, mentor junior engineers, and drive continuous improvements in engineering practices.
- Work end-to-end from development to production on key product features.
Interview Process
The interview process for the Software Engineer role at BrowserStack typically involves the following stages:
- Technical Screening: Coding test on platforms like HackerRank or a custom in-house test focusing on problem-solving and algorithmic skills.
- Technical Interview: A 1-hour technical round involving live coding and system design questions.
- Behavioral Round: Discuss your work experience, team collaboration, and problem-solving approach. Expect questions like “Tell us about a challenging project you worked on.”
- Final Interview: Discussion about company culture, expectations, and vision alignment.
Relevant Technologies
Brush up on the following technologies to increase your chances of acing the interview:
Interview Tips and Tricks
- Practice coding under time pressure on platforms like LeetCode and HackerRank.
- Prepare for system design questions by studying scalable system architectures.
- Learn to communicate your thought process clearly during coding and problem-solving rounds.
- Review BrowserStack’s core products and the company’s mission to align your answers with their values.
Company Reviews
BrowserStack has consistently been recognized for its excellent work culture and competitive compensation:
- Work Culture: A collaborative, transparent, and open environment that fosters innovation and growth.
- Salary Range: Competitive salaries ranging from ₹15-20 LPA, with additional benefits like unlimited time off.
- Employee Feedback: Employees praise BrowserStack for its focus on career growth and work-life balance. Highly rated on Glassdoor and LinkedIn.